Two weekends ago I took down two tournaments in one night, one of the Daily Doubles for $1.9k and the Fifty-Fifty for about $10k. Obviously my biggest night ever.

However, since then I've seen my bankroll decrease nearly 33%. Its quite alarming that I've lost all this back through MTTs but I suppose its just standard? I feel like I'm playing quite well, if not better, but just need to win a few more key races per tournament to be able to do anything serious.

Since I am losing money though I'm going to try to employ stricter bankroll management rules this week. My roll is at $10kish. Thats 100 buy-ins of $100 events. Its 66 buy-ins of $150 events and I really like playing the nightly $65k. I suppose I'll try satelliting into that event from now on, as well as the Sunday Majors.

I'm going to avoid playing the $50 rebuy for sure and possibly the $30r although probably not actually, haha. I still think I can swing that one for now.

Also, I really wanna only play a handful of events per day. I feel like I play too many at times and auto-pilot quite often.

Sorry for the lack of updates fellas. Wow, its been over 2 months since my last post.

Since shipping $1100 in the UB $200k, I've actually switched poker rooms and now play nearly exclusively on Full Tilt. The tournaments are larger and I feel like there is more money to win there. Sadly with this comes bigger playing fields as well, but I'm surviving. My roll is at $5.2k right now.

Last Sunday I finished 3rd/~5200 in MSOP Event #15, good for the largest cash of my career at $4,500. The event lasted over 8 hours and at the end of it I fell over fast asleep. I plan on writing a Tournament Report sometime in the near future.

Currently, I'm playing $10 and $20 rebuys as well as any tournament over $24+2. I say that with my bankroll, the highest I should be playing are the $69+6s, but I am dabbling fairly occasionally in a few $100+9s as well.

Overall things have been super-swingy and while yes I did have the largest cash of my career a week ago I still don't think I'm playing consistently well. I have flashes of excellence but I think overall I'm just not bringing my A-game to the table at all times. Meh. But I'll continue grinding.

Cash games have been meh and I really only dabble in them now. I was losing a ton playing NL100 and while I still may go back after some review, I'm done with them for now and focusing solely on tournaments.
